A Child & Child pendant with hand engraved ground of swirling leaves enamelled in green, set with three red gemstones with a pendant drop of boulder opal the whole mounted to the reverse with a paua shell plaque which glitters through the pierced leaf shapes. In the original box, printed in gold to the inside of the lid Child & Child 35 Alfred Place West, Queens Gate. This piece was produced between 1891 - 1899.
